> The Hopperizer recognizes both Beta Code and B-Greek transliteration schemes.
>
> Louis' transliteration of 1Tim 5:9 was given in Beta Code rather than B-Greek. As noted, the key (though not only) difference is the mapping of X and C.
>
> Instead of converting 1 Tim 5:9 to B-Greek, an alternative is to simply change the Hopperizer's setting from B-Greek to Beta Code.
>
> The bug with capitalization that Dr. Conrad discovered has [fingers crossed] been fixed.

> > This didn't quite work correctly, the reason being that the
> > transliteration here used "X" for Chi rather than the standard B-Greek
> > transliteration's "C." Also (H should be hH
> >
> > After making the proper alterations, the transliteration reads:
> > KATA\ TW=N PARASCO/NTWN XRH/SETAI. KATE/LIPE DE\ DU/O PAI=DAS E)K
> > *SAMI/AS GUNAIKO\S TW=N EU)DOKI/MWN, *hHLIODW/ROU TINO\S
> > QUGATRO/S: QUGATE/RA <DE\> MI/AN E)/SCEN, H(\ PAI=S E)/TI OU)=SA PRO\
> >
> > and the Hopperizer yields:
> >
> > κατὰ τῶν παρασχόντων ξρήσεται.
> > κατέλιπε δὲ δύο παῖδας ἐκ *σαμίας
> > γυναικὸς τῶν εὐδοκίμων, *ἡλιοδώρου
> > τινὸς θυγατρός: θυγατέρα <δὲ> μίαν
> > ἔσχεν, ἣ παῖς ἔτι οὖσα πρὸ
> >
> > It should be noted that *SAMI/AS is actually Σαμίας. That means
> > that this is not an
> > instance of EK MIAS GUNAIKOS at all: (Demosthenes) had two children
> > from a Samian wife ...
